    George Foreman buried in Sioux City, IA (my home town)

    From Google search AI summary.

    According to family announcements on April 16, 2026, boxing legend George Foreman was laid to rest in Sioux City, Iowa, following his death in March 2025. He was buried at Logan Park Cemetery in a location overlooking the Loess Hills, fulfilling a long-held wish inspired by a 1988 trip to the area.

    • Final Resting Place: Logan Park Cemetery in Sioux City, Iowa, chosen for the sense of peace he felt during a visit to the region.
    • Burial Date: April 17, 2025.
    • Monument: An 8-foot monument, including a depiction of Foreman in his Olympic uniform waving an American flag, was installed in April 2026.
    • Significance: Foreman, who lived in Houston, Texas, had often spoken of the Loess Hills to his family, who honored his request to be buried there.
    • Memorial Activity: A memorial service/celebration of life was also held in Houston in April 2025.

    Family representatives indicated they chose this location to honor his long-held desire, noting that the spot matched the peaceful description he often shared.
